Biecz, or Polish Carcassonne - how to get here?

Biecz, due to its unique history and impressive buildings, is sometimes called Little Cracow. No wonder that tourists like to visit this town located on the border of the Beskid Niski and Ciężkowice Foothills. The Pearl of Eastern Little Poland has really a lot to offer! So how to get here? Baytsh is located by the DK 28 road, between Jasło and Gorlice. Biecz is less than 50 km from Tarnów, and less than 55 km from Nowy Sącz. To get to the A4 freeway, connecting east and west of Poland, you need to drive approximately 60 km. Biecz can also be reached by train or bus.

Baytsh is one of the oldest towns in Lesser Poland. Due to numerous medieval buildings, it is known as the "Pearl of Małopolska" or "Polish Carcassonne". It is an ideal place for those who want to see as much as possible within a relatively small area.

Pompeii - a tour of the ancient city

This is one of the biggest tourist attractions in Italy - a place besieged by tourists, regardless of the season. The ruins of the ancient city, whose power was annihilated during the eruption of Mount Vesuvius, are quite a treat for lovers of antiquity and history in general. The city was "hibernated" in a layer of ash and pumice. Pompeii began to revive like a Phoenix from the ashes only in the 18th century, when excavations began. Archaeological work continues to this day.

Pompeii is an Italian city that was destroyed during the Roman Empire by the eruption of the Vesuvius volcano. Lava and volcanic ash perpetuated the buildings, objects used by the settlers and even their bodies. Pompeii is considered by historians to be a symbol of antiquity.
